DANGER!
Hazard of electrical shock! Circuit potentials are up to 240VAC above earth ground.
Capacitors retain charge after power is removed. Disconnect power and wait until
the voltage between B+ and B- is 0VDC before servicing the drive.
Do not connect mains power to the output terminals (U, V, W)! Severe damage to
the drive will result.
Do not cycle mains power more than once every three minutes. Damage to the
drive will result.
